**Introduction**
The DIY PC community thrives on flexibility, innovation, and self‑expression. Open‑source motherboard architectures are democratizing PC building by making comprehensive schematics, firmware, and design tools accessible to anyone. This transformative approach enables hobbyists—and even professionals—to customize and innovate their systems without being locked into proprietary ecosystems. This article explores how open‑source motherboard projects are fostering collaborative innovation, reducing costs, and enabling a new era of personalized computing.
**Technological Innovations**
- **Publicly Available Schematics and CAD Models:**
Communities offer detailed, open‑source blueprints and design files that allow users to understand, modify, and improve motherboard designs at a granular level.
- **Modular and Interoperable Designs:**
Standardized interfaces between motherboard components ensure that upgrades and replacements are as simple as plugging in a new module.
- **Customizable Firmware and BIOS:**
Open‑source firmware projects empower users to fine‑tune system boot processes, optimize performance, and implement advanced security protocols directly at the hardware level.
- **Collaborative Development Ecosystem:**
Platforms that host open‑source hardware designs encourage global collaboration, where developers share improvements, troubleshoot issues collectively, and iterate on designs quickly.
**Applications and Benefits**
- **Cost‑Effective Customization:**
Open‑source motherboard architectures reduce the need for expensive, proprietary systems, allowing users to build and upgrade PCs economically.
- **Enhanced Learning and Innovation:**
Aspiring engineers and tech enthusiasts gain hands‑on experience and technical knowledge through participation in a vibrant, collaborative community.
- **Future‑Proof Systems:**
Modular, open designs adapt more easily to new technologies, ensuring that DIY PCs remain current and competitive as hardware standards evolve.
- **Broad Community Support:**
Global communities foster an environment of shared learning and support, enabling users to find solutions and innovative ideas that push the limits of personal computing.
**Future Directions**
The future of open‑source motherboard architectures may incorporate AI‑driven design tools, cloud‑based simulation platforms, and enhanced collaboration interfaces that further simplify customization and upgrade processes. As manufacturing techniques evolve, these open architectures will become increasingly accessible, heralding a new era of decentralized innovation in PC building.
